tp官方下载安卓最新版本2024|tp官网下载/tp安卓版下载/Tpwallet官方最新版|TP官方网址下载

TP系统如何添加马蹄莲:从市场监测到合约性能的全链路解读

在TP生态里“添加马蹄莲”,通常不是指把真实花卉插进界面那么简单,而是把一种“资产/策略/应用模块(以马蹄莲为代称)”以可管理、可追踪、可交易、可通知、可审计的方式接入系统。由于不同TP产品(钱包、交易所、分布式应用DApp、企业链系统等)具体实现差异很大,以下我将以“可落地的通用接入流程”为骨架,全面解读你要求的角度:市场监测报告、便捷资金转账、多链钱包管理、分布式应用、交易日志、交易通知、合约性能。你可以把它当作一份“从需求到上链”的接入说明与工程检查清单。

一、前置定义:先确定“马蹄莲”在TP里代表什么

1)如果马蹄莲是“代币/资产”

- 你需要确认:合约地址、链ID、代币符号、精度(decimals)、合约是否标准(ERC20/其他)、是否可代币化转账。

2)如果马蹄莲是“策略/模块/协议”

- 你需要确认:模块地址或配置入口、调用参数(如池子、路由、费率)、升级方式、依赖合约。

3)如果马蹄莲是“DApp/分布式应用”

- 你需要确认:前端入口、合约交互方式、后端服务是否需要预处理数据、是否采用多链部署。

建议你在开始前做一份“马蹄莲元数据卡片”:

- 名称:马蹄莲

- 类型:资产/策略/应用

- 网络:主网/测试网/多链

- 唯一标识:合约地址/应用ID

- 关键参数:decimals、路由、权限

二、市场监测报告:接入前先把“价格与风险”看清

要在TP系统中稳定运行“马蹄莲”,市场监测报告是第一道门。它的核心目的不是“看看价格”,而是把后续交易、通知、风控参数统一起来。

1)监测内容建议

- 价格:现价、买卖价差、短时波动

- 流动性:深度、滑点估算、换手

- 交易量:24h/7d、异常峰值

- 重大事件:合约升级、交易对变化、黑名单/冻结风险(如果涉及)

- 交易失败率:历史调用成功/失败统计

2)输出格式要能被系统消费

- 统一为“结构化数据”而不是截图

- 字段至少包括:token/appId、timestamp、source、price、liquidity、riskScore、confidence

3)如何“添加马蹄莲”与报告联动

- 在TP添加马蹄莲的配置页,把监测源和阈值写入:

- 例如:当riskScore>0.8触发风控

- 当滑点>阈值提示用户

- 这样你在点击“添加”后,系统就具备了持续决策能力。

三、便捷资金转账:让添加后的交互从“能用”到“顺畅”

添加马蹄莲后最现实的问题是:资金怎么到位?转账怎么更快更稳?

1)常见资金路径

- 直接链上转账:从用户钱包到马蹄莲相关合约地址(如做交互需要approve/转入)

- 间接转账:先跨链换资产/再路由到目标池

- 先授权后交易:先approve,再swap/存入/调用策略

2)便捷体验的工程要点

- 自动估算Gas:提示预计费用并给出上限

- 自动重试策略:当网络拥堵导致失败,采用合理重试(需防重放/防重复执行)

- 额度管理:对approve设置最小必要额度,避免长期高授权

- 批处理(若支持):将approve与后续动作合并(取决于链与合约设计)

3)“添加马蹄莲”时应同步配置转账项

- 需要哪些token:手续费token、交易token、抵押token

- 授权范围:授权多少、授权到哪个合约

- 交易路由:直接路由还是经由聚合器

四、多链钱包管理:一次添加,覆盖多网络的现实复杂度

TP里的用户往往不仅在一条链上使用。要真正“添加马蹄莲”,就必须完成多链钱包管理的适配。

1)多链常见难点

- 同一资产在不同链可能合约不同

- 不同链的Gas计费方式不同

- 地址格式不同但语义相近(如EVM兼容链通常地址一致)

- nonce管理与链上确认速度不同

2)管理策略

- 钱包“账户映射”:同一用户在多个链上对应不同地址

- 会话隔离:每笔交易绑定链ID与nonce

- 资产列表分链展示:马蹄莲在不同链以不同“条目”出现,但共享统一名称与元数据卡片

- 预设默认链与切换提示:减少误发

3)建议你在TP配置中实现

- chainConfig:{chainId, rpc, explorerUrl, contractAddress}

- walletConfig:{supportedChains, addressDerivation, gasPolicy}

五、分布式应用:把“马蹄莲”当作可交互组件部署

如果马蹄莲在TP里是一个DApp或策略模块,那么它应当以分布式应用方式被接入:前端UI、链上合约、后端服务、索引器共同协作。

1)分布式系统的组成

- 前端:显示马蹄莲信息、发起交互

- 合约:执行资金流与状态变更

- 索引器/后端:读取事件、聚合状态、提供查询接口

- 缓存与速率限制:避免RPC被打爆

2)添加动作如何落到分布式架构

- 注册应用元数据:appId、链路、事件类型

- 订阅事件:例如Swap、Deposit、Withdraw、Transfer(按需)

- 统一状态机:把链上事件转为“UI可理解状态”

六、交易日志:让每一次交互可审计、可回放

交易日志是“添加马蹄莲”稳定运行的底座。没有日志,就很难解释用户的每一次失败或延迟。

1)日志应该记录什么

- 交易标识:txHash、chainId、nonce、时间戳

- 发起上下文:用户ID(或匿名ID)、交互类型(转账/存入/兑换)

- 参数摘要:合约地址、关键参数hash(避免泄露敏感信息)

- 结果:成功/失败、回执码、失败原因(revert理由或错误码)

- 状态更新:订单/仓位/余额变更前后

2)日志的关键格式建议

- JSON结构化字段,便于检索与告警

- 可对接ELK/链上索引数据库

3)与“添加马蹄莲”联动

- 当用户添加后系统应把该资产/模块的事件类型纳入日志采集范围

七、交易通知:把状态从“链上发生”变成“用户收到并理解”

添加马蹄莲后,通知系统要覆盖从发起到确认的全流程。

1)通知时机

- 已提交(pending):提供txHash与预计确认时间

- 已确认(confirmed):更新余额/订单状态

- 失败(failed):给出原因摘要与可能解决建议

- 重大风控触发:例如riskScore超阈值

2)通知内容要清晰

- 不只说“成功/失败”,还要说“做了什么”(例如:已为马蹄莲策略完成存入)

- 提供可点击的浏览器链接

- 避免让用户自己猜参数

3)多链下的通知一致性

- 通知必须携带chainId

- 同一操作跨链拆分时要用“关联ID”把多个tx织成一条用户体验链路

八、合约性能:在“能用”之外追求“快、稳、可控成本”

最后一关是合约性能与整体系统性能。添加马蹄莲不应只是配置完成,而应达到可接受的执行成本与成功率。

1)合约性能评估维度

- Gas消耗:典型路径的gas区间

- 成功率:在网络拥堵/极端滑点条件下的失败表现

- 可升级性:合约升级是否需要管理员权限,是否有时间锁

- 事件与索引效率:事件是否足够、字段是否可用于后端查询

2)系统侧性能(不仅合约)

- RPC可用性与延迟

- 索引器落后程度(event indexing delay)

- 并发处理能力(大量用户同时添加/交易)

3)如何把性能指标用回“添加马蹄莲”流程

- 接入时进行基准测试:估算gas、测调用成功率

- 在TP配置中加入性能阈值:例如gas上限、最大滑点、最大重试次数

- 以合约版本或路由版本区分:防止同名马蹄莲指向不同实现导致体验差

九、一个通用“添加马蹄莲”的落地流程(汇总清单)

1)准备元数据:合约/应用ID、链ID、精度、路由与参数

2)接入市场监测:配置监测源、风险阈值、流动性阈值

3)配置资金交互:转账路径、approve策略、Gas策略与重试策略

4)启用多链:建立chainConfig与wallet映射,避免误链

5)注册分布式模块:事件订阅、索引器配置、状态机映射

6)落地交易日志:统一字段、可检索、可回放

7)完善交易通知:pending/confirmed/failed/风控触发与多链关联

8)做合约与系统性能基准:成功率、gas区间、索引延迟

结语

当你在TP系统中“添加马蹄莲”,本质上是把一个资产/策略/应用模块纳入全链路治理:从市场监测报告的风控判断,到便捷资金转账的交易体验;从多链钱包管理的安全与一致,到分布式应用的可交互与可维护;从交易日志的审计与回放,到交易通知的用户理解;最终由合约性能与系统性能决定其长期可用性。把这七个角度一起做,你的添加动作才是真正“可上线、可运营、可追责”。

作者:林岚观澜发布时间:2026-04-09 17:55:33

评论

相关阅读